What is media digitization?

Media digitization is the process of converting analog media—such as photographs, films, audio tapes, and documents—into digital formats. This process involves using specialized equipment and software to create high-quality digital copies that can be stored, accessed, and preserved more efficiently. Media digitization helps protect valuable content from deterioration, makes it easier to share and distribute, and allows for improved organization and searchability. It is essential for archival purposes, digital libraries, and adapting content for modern digital platforms.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a media digitization specialist?

To thrive as a Media Digitization Specialist, you need expertise in handling analog and digital media formats, knowledge of preservation standards, and often a background in library science or archival studies. Familiarity with digitization hardware (like scanners and audio/video converters), digital asset management systems, and relevant software such as Adobe Creative Suite is typically required. Attention to detail, strong organizational skills, and effective communication are vital soft skills for managing large collections and collaborating with stakeholders. These abilities ensure the accurate preservation, accessibility, and integrity of valuable media assets throughout the digitization process.

What are some common challenges faced in a media digitization role, and how can they be managed effectively?

Media digitization professionals often encounter challenges such as handling delicate or deteriorating physical media, ensuring consistent quality during conversion, and managing large volumes of files with proper metadata. To address these, it's important to follow best practices in preservation, use calibrated equipment, and adhere to established workflows for file naming and archiving. Collaboration with archivists, IT specialists, and project managers can help streamline processes and resolve technical or organizational issues quickly.

What is the difference between Media Digitization vs Media Preservation Specialist?

AspectMedia DigitizationMedia Preservation Specialist
CredentialsDigital imaging, media handling certificationsConservation, archival, or preservation certifications
Work EnvironmentDigital labs, scanning stations, editing suitesArchives, museums, conservation labs
Industry UsageMedia companies, archives, librariesArchives, museums, cultural institutions
Primary FocusConverting analog media to digital formatsMaintaining and restoring physical media for longevity

Media Digitization involves converting physical media into digital formats for easier access and preservation. Media Preservation Specialists focus on conserving and restoring physical media to prevent deterioration. While both roles work with media preservation, digitization emphasizes creating digital copies, whereas preservation emphasizes physical media care.
